When Is It Too Hot to Shingle a Roof

Determining When It’s Too Hot to Shingle a Roof

Installing a roof can be challenging, especially under extreme temperatures. For homeowners and contractors in the United States, one concern is knowing when it’s too hot to shingle a roof. High temperatures can affect the performance, durability, and safety of asphalt shingles. How Heat Affects Asphalt Shingle Installation

Asphalt shingles rely on adhesive strips activated by heat to seal properly and create a water-resistant barrier. When temperatures climb too high, shingles soften excessively, making them prone to damage during installation.

High heat causes shingles to become sticky and can deform if walked on improperly. This can lead to premature cracking or tearing. Excessive heat also accelerates adhesive bonding, reducing working time and increasing the risk of improperly aligned shingles.

Additionally, hot shingles can be more difficult to handle, and installers may inadvertently cause damage or nail placement errors. These factors combined can compromise the overall roof integrity.

Optimal Temperature Range for Shingling

Most roofing manufacturers recommend installing asphalt shingles when the ambient temperature is between 40°F and 85°F. Below 40°F, shingles become brittle and may crack. Above 85°F, shingles tend to be excessively soft and tacky.

Within this temperature range, shingles remain flexible enough for handling without brittleness, and the adhesive strip activates properly without premature bonding. Following manufacturer guidelines is crucial to maintain shingle warranty coverage.

Risks of Shingling in Excessive Heat

Material Performance Issues

Extreme heat causes several problems for roofing materials:

  • Shingle Softening: Increases risk of tearing, deformation, and damage during nail application.
  • Adhesive Overactivation: Leads to shingles bonding prematurely before proper alignment.
  • Reduced Working Time: Limited opportunity to reposition shingles once placed.
  • Expansion and Warping: Heat can cause shingles to expand and warp, affecting roof appearance.

Safety and Work Productivity Concerns

  • Heat Exhaustion Risks: Workers face dehydration and heat stroke, reducing efficiency.
  • Sun Exposure: Direct sunlight can raise roof surface temperatures higher than air temperature.
  • Fire Hazard: Some materials or hot tools on hot roofs may increase fire risk.

Best Practices for Roofing in Hot Weather

When high temperatures exceed optimal installation ranges, following precautions can minimize risks:

  • Schedule Work During Cooler Hours: Early mornings or late afternoons offer lower surface temperatures.
  • Hydrate Constantly: Provide water breaks and shade to prevent worker heat exhaustion.
  • Use Protective Gear: Light-colored clothing, hats, and sunscreen help shield workers from sun.
  • Handle Shingles Gently: Minimize walking on shingles and store materials in shaded areas.
  • Avoid Installing on Extremely Hot Roof Surfaces: Heat radiating from rooftops can surpass ambient air temperature by 20-30°F.

How Roof Material Choice Influences Heat Installation

Asphalt shingles are sensitive to high temperatures compared to other roofing options. For regions with frequent extreme heat, alternatives like tile, metal, or synthetic roofs may offer better performance during summer months.

Some manufacturers produce heat-resistant asphalt shingles designed to maintain stability at higher temperatures. However, installers should still adhere to temperature guidelines and use manufacturer recommendations.

How to Assess Roof Surface Temperature

Air temperature alone can be misleading when evaluating if it’s too hot to shingle. Roof decking exposed to direct sunlight can reach temperatures over 130°F on hot days.

Using an infrared thermometer to monitor roof surface temperature helps determine safe working conditions. If surface temperatures exceed manufacturer limits—typically around 85-100°F—postpone installation until conditions improve.
